Panasonic FH1 vs Ricoh WG-4 GPS Overview

In this article, we will be comparing the Panasonic FH1 versus Ricoh WG-4 GPS, former being a Small Sensor Compact while the latter is a Waterproof by rivals Panasonic and Ricoh. There is a large difference among the image resolutions of the FH1 (12MP) and WG-4 GPS (16MP) but they use the same exact sensor measurements (1/2.3").

Panasonic FH1 vs Ricoh WG-4 GPS Physical Comparison

In case you're going to carry your camera regularly, you should factor in its weight and dimensions. The Panasonic FH1 offers external dimensions of 98mm x 55mm x 23mm (3.9" x 2.2" x 0.9") with a weight of 163 grams (0.36 lbs) while the Ricoh WG-4 GPS has dimensions of 124mm x 64mm x 33mm (4.9" x 2.5" x 1.3") having a weight of 235 grams (0.52 lbs).

Panasonic FH1 vs Ricoh WG-4 GPS Sensor Comparison

Generally, it is tough to visualize the difference in sensor sizing purely by going through specifications. The graphic below might give you a more clear sense of the sensor dimensions in the FH1 and WG-4 GPS.

Plainly, both cameras enjoy the same exact sensor sizing albeit different MP. You can expect the Ricoh WG-4 GPS to produce more detail having its extra 4 Megapixels. Higher resolution will allow you to crop shots far more aggressively. The older FH1 will be disadvantaged with regard to sensor innovation.
